Cast Contemporary Sculpture

From the Walla Walla Foundry

Saturday, August 30th - Sunday, September 28th, 1997


Founded in 1980 by Mark Anderson, the Walla Walla Foundry specializes in casting contemporary fine art and has become one of North America’s most prominent foundries. Cast Contemporary Sculpture includes both sculpture and selected works on paper by the artists Robert Arneson, David Bates, Frank Boyden, Squire Broel, John Buck, Deborah Butterfield, Jim Dine, Marilyn Lysohir, Manuel Neri, Brad Rude, and Sandra Shannonhouse. For this exhibit, sculpture will be installed both in the gallery, and in the halls adjacent to the gallery as well as on the Whitman College grounds.
